Hey Everyone, Just wondering does it matter if a stingray should be first in the tank before adding other fish? Or it doesn't matter when to add the stingray to an existing community?
Dont think it makes a big difference, just be sure your tank can handle the bioload of a ray because they are big n messy and produce tons of ammonia. And make sure tankmates arent small enough to be covered by the disc or they may end up as snacks
I always make sure fish are used to the tank first. If you add fish after the ray is already established the ray will have a better chance of pouncing on the fish and trying to eat it
